Solar Panel Energy Efficiency and Degradation Over

Degradation Due to Light Induction: This occurrence affects solar panels, in which efficiency is reduced temporarily at the primary exposure of sunlight. This is due to the motion of boron and oxygen within the silicon cells.

How Efficient Are Solar Panels?

The individual solar cells determine how efficient the solar panel and wider system is. Solar panel efficiency Efficiency is measured under standard test conditions (STC). Based on a cell temperature of 25 °C, solar irradiance of 1000W/m 2 and air mass of 1.5. Total solar panel efficiency is based on the maximum power rating (Watts) at STC

Effect of Light Intensity

Changing the light intensity incident on a solar cell changes all solar cell parameters, including the short-circuit current, the open-circuit voltage, the FF, the efficiency and the impact of series and shunt resistances.The light intensity on a solar cell is called the number of suns, where 1 sun corresponds to standard illumination at AM1.5, or 1 kW/m 2.
